Africa Faces Dual Health Crises with Marburg and Mpox Outbreaks

Rwanda sees a decline in Marburg cases, while mpox spreads rapidly across 18 African countries, prompting urgent calls for international support.

  • Rwanda reports a significant reduction in Marburg virus cases, with no new infections or deaths in recent days.
  • The Marburg virus, related to Ebola, has a high fatality rate, but efforts in Rwanda show promising results with ongoing vaccine trials.
  • Mpox has resulted in over 1,100 deaths across Africa this year, with the Democratic Republic of Congo being the epicenter of the outbreak.
  • The mpox outbreak has spread to 18 African countries, with Zambia and Zimbabwe recently reporting their first cases.
  • African health officials urge the international community to fulfill financial and vaccine pledges to combat the growing mpox crisis.
